The median weekly rent in Saint Johns is $684, based on 63 new tenancy bonds lodged in Q1 2026. That is 10% above the Auckland-wide median of $622.

Over the past year the median has fallen 2.6%, and it is up 12% on Q1 2020, when the median was $600.

Most new tenancies fall between $585 and $762 a week — the middle half of the market.

Saint Johns is the 109th most expensive of the 246 Auckland suburbs we track — pricier than 56% of them.

What is the average rent in Saint Johns?
The median weekly rent for a new tenancy in Saint Johns is $684 (Q1 2026), from 63 bonds lodged with Tenancy Services. We use the median rather than a simple average because it is not distorted by a handful of very high or very low rents.
Are rents in Saint Johns going up or down?
Rents are easing — the median is down 2.6% on the same quarter last year. Over five years the median has moved +11.8%.
How much is a three-bedroom in Saint Johns?
A one-bedroom is typically $606 a week, a two-bedroom $565, a three-bedroom $670, a four-bedroom $930.
Is Saint Johns expensive compared with the rest of Auckland?
At $684 a week, Saint Johns is above the Auckland median of $622. Saint Johns is the 109th most expensive of the 246 Auckland suburbs we track — pricier than 56% of them.
What rental yield does Saint Johns produce?
Gross yield depends on the purchase price. At the Saint Johns median rent of $684 a week, annual rent is about $35,568. Divide that by the property price for gross yield — $35,568 on a $900,000 property is roughly 4.0%.
